Beatmup
Beatmup::Audio::BasicRealtimePlayback Member List

This is the complete list of members for Beatmup::Audio::BasicRealtimePlayback, including all inherited members.

AbstractPlayback()Beatmup::Audio::AbstractPlaybackprotected
advanceTime()Beatmup::Audio::AbstractPlaybackprotected
afterProcessing(ThreadIndex threadCount, GraphicPipeline *gpu, bool aborted)Beatmup::AbstractTaskvirtual
BasicRealtimePlayback(OutputMode)Beatmup::Audio::BasicRealtimePlaybackprotected
beforeProcessing(ThreadIndex threadCount, ProcessingTarget target, GraphicPipeline *gpu)Beatmup::Audio::AbstractPlaybackvirtual
bufferQueueCallbackFunc()Beatmup::Audio::BasicRealtimePlaybackinline
buffersBeatmup::Audio::BasicRealtimePlaybackprivate
bufferSizeBeatmup::Audio::BasicRealtimePlaybackprotected
clockBeatmup::Audio::AbstractPlaybackprotected
createBuffer(const AbstractPlayback::Mode &mode) constBeatmup::Audio::BasicRealtimePlaybackprotectedvirtual
fillIndexBeatmup::Audio::BasicRealtimePlaybackprivate
freeBuffer(sample8 *buffer) constBeatmup::Audio::BasicRealtimePlaybackprotectedvirtual
freeBuffers()Beatmup::Audio::BasicRealtimePlaybackprivate
getMaxThreads() constBeatmup::Audio::AbstractPlaybackvirtual
getSource() constBeatmup::Audio::AbstractPlaybackinline
getUsedDevices() constBeatmup::AbstractTaskvirtual
initialize(Mode mode)Beatmup::Audio::BasicRealtimePlaybackvirtual
modeBeatmup::Audio::AbstractPlaybackprotected
numBuffersBeatmup::Audio::BasicRealtimePlaybackprivate
outputModeBeatmup::Audio::BasicRealtimePlaybackprivate
OutputMode enum nameBeatmup::Audio::BasicRealtimePlaybackprotected
playIndexBeatmup::Audio::BasicRealtimePlaybackprivate
playingBufferOffsetBeatmup::Audio::BasicRealtimePlaybackprivate
prepareBuffers(const AbstractPlayback::Mode &mode)Beatmup::Audio::BasicRealtimePlaybackprivate
process(TaskThread &thread)Beatmup::Audio::BasicRealtimePlaybackvirtual
processOnGPU(GraphicPipeline &gpu, TaskThread &thread)Beatmup::AbstractTaskvirtual
pullBuffer(sample8 *buffer, dtime numFrames)Beatmup::Audio::BasicRealtimePlayback
pushBuffer(sample8 *buffer, int bufferIndex)Beatmup::Audio::BasicRealtimePlaybackinlineprotectedvirtual
sendIndexBeatmup::Audio::BasicRealtimePlaybackprivate
setSource(Source *source)Beatmup::Audio::AbstractPlaybackinline
skipFramesBeatmup::Audio::BasicRealtimePlaybackprivate
sourceBeatmup::Audio::AbstractPlaybackprotected
start()Beatmup::Audio::BasicRealtimePlaybackvirtual
stop()=0Beatmup::Audio::BasicRealtimePlaybackpure virtual
TaskDeviceRequirement enum nameBeatmup::AbstractTask
validThreadCount(int number)Beatmup::AbstractTaskstatic
~BasicRealtimePlayback()Beatmup::Audio::BasicRealtimePlaybackvirtual
~Object()Beatmup::Objectinlinevirtual